This time I picked out a bathroom scale. I got the Trimmer Square Glass Digital Bathroom Scale in Chrome.
The price was $42.13 and marked down to $31.60.



Our old scale would not hold its batteries. I had the hardest time figuring out how much weight I've lost with the old scale.

The Trimmer Square Glass Digital Bathroom Scale n Chrome is perfect! It will even weigh my little guy.


My top five favorite features of this scale are:
  1. Weighs up to 330 pounds
  2. It has long lasting lithium batteries {that were included}
  3. The tempered safety glass {that looks stylish}
  4. LCD display
  5. Tap-on technology to start and auto switch off in 6 seconds


Overall dimensions: 3" H x 14" W x 14" D. It fits great in our small bathroom.

Low Fat Granola

I got this recipe from Jolly Mom.

We sprinkle this granola on this homemade cereal.

Here's the recipe:


Instructions:

Preheat oven to 300 degrees.

  1. In a large mixing bowl, combine oats, nuts, flax seeds, wheat germ, cinnamon, and salt. Set aside.
  2. In a small saucepan, warm the applesauce, brown sugar, honey, vanilla extract, and oil over low heat.
  3. Add the applesauce mixture to the oat mixture and stir until everything is evenly coated.
  4. Spread the mixture onto two baking sheets. Make sure you have an even layer and the pans aren't crowded. Bake for 30-40 minutes, stirring every 10 minutes, until the granola is a golden brown color.
  5. Remove from oven and allow to cool completely before eating or storing in an airtight container. The granola may seem like it's a bit mushy in parts when it comes out of the oven, but once it cools it will harden and develop that wonderful crunch granola is known for.

Additions:

  1. We added dried blueberries and cranberries that I bought from Costco.
  2. You can use other nuts.
